Population Overview
Culloden CDP is a small community located in West Virginia. The total population is 3,158. It ranks as the 48th most populous out of 430 cities and towns in West Virginia.
Age Demographics
The median age in Culloden CDP is 41.9 years. This is 2% lower than the state median of 42.7 years.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Culloden CDP is $89,519. This is 55% higher than the state median of $57,917.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 14% higher. The poverty rate stands at 10.2%. This is 39% lower than the state poverty rate of 16.6%. The unemployment rate is 3.0%. This is 48% lower than the state rate of 5.7%. The median home value is $199,700. Housing costs are 28% higher than the state median of $155,600.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 2.2x, Culloden CDP is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 87.5%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 18% higher than the state average of 74.3%.
Race & Ethnicity
Culloden CDP has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 91.6% of all residents. Asian residents account for 2.2%. The Asian population is significantly higher than the state average (2.2% vs 0.8%).
Education
41.0%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This places Culloden CDP in the top 10% of all cities in the state for educational attainment. This is 76% higher than the state rate of 23.3%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 96.1%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Culloden CDP, West Virginia is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against West Virginia state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 430 Census-designated places in West Virginia. For official data, visit data.census.gov.
